  • 지난 25일 대진대학교 실내체육관에서 2012 세계대학태권도선수권대회 개회식에서 K타이거즈 시범단이 태권도 시범을 선보였다.
    K타이거즈 시범단의 태권도 시범을 [무카스 TV]에서 만나보자.
